Ecommerce Mobile App Development: Should You Make an App for Your Online Store?11 min read

Ecommerce Mobile App Development: Should You Make an App for Your Online Store?11 min read

04/12/2018 0 By Vasyl Tsyktor

With the growth of the mobile Ecommerce market, business owners turn towards the app development for their online stores. According to eMarketer, mobile Ecommerce sales reached the value of $1.8 trillion forming 63.5% of the overall online sales in 2018 compared to $1.36 trillion (58.9% of total Ecommerce sales) in 2017.


However, this statistics shows that users tend to make purchases online through mobile devices but there’s nothing about mobile apps in this data. The question is whether an Ecommerce mobile app in addition to your existing online store is what you really need to boost your sales. Let’s consider the benefits and drawbacks of the Ecommerce app development.


Your website should be responsive to meet Google’s user interface design guidelines. If so, then it will be easier for your customers to make purchases in your online store. However, mobile apps can provide a totally different user experience.

Improved marketing capabilities

One of the most important advantages of Ecommerce mobile apps over responsive online stores is push notifications. Even though you can send push notifications through your website to both Android devices and desktops, iOS still doesn’t support web push notifications. It means that only a native mobile app can deliver notifications to iOS-based devices.


Unlike desktops, users always have access to their mobile devices. This enables brands to reach their target audience whenever they have what to say. Push notifications also allow businesses to timely tell about new items in their stores, inform about discounts or special offers, and build wise marketing strategies regardless of where their potential customers are. While users can easily opt-out in order to no longer receive web notifications, they can remove a mobile app to disable brands to send spam to their devices. You should remember this when building your notification content plan.

Simplified buying process

Both websites and mobile apps require users to type in their payment card information like primary account number, expiry date, and CVV2 to make a purchase possible in the case where Apple Pay and Google Pay aren’t available. However, the buying process in mobile apps looks simpler than in online stores. When it comes to two-factor authentication, mobile apps can automatically process one-time passwords (OTPs) sent by payment systems via push notifications. Therefore, users don’t need to open an SMS with an OTP and type it in a certain field on a website.

Speed of work

The web page loading speed plays an important role in how customers make purchases. According to Kissmetrics, potential customers may abandon your online store if it takes more than 3 seconds to deliver a web page to the visitors. It means that your website should be extremely fast to generate more sales.


However, mobile apps are faster than responsive sites since the latter use web servers to store data, unlike apps that store data locally on a mobile device. Furthermore, mobile apps can store static content right on a smartphone, unlike sites that generate all content every time users visit them. Even if you enabled browser caching for your website, it will make sense only for those web pages a certain user has already visited. It will take more time to load other pages this user visits for the first time.


On the Internet, you can find a lot of blog posts describing the advantages of mobile apps over responsive websites. However, the Ecommerce mobile app development can turn out to be an ineffective investment since it has a set of significant drawbacks.

Visitors are unlikely to install your app to make a single purchase

Excluding your social accounts, your website is most likely to be the first communication channel between you and your potential customers. At least, they first visit your website and then install your app if they need it. Moreover, they will hardly download it if they need to make only one purchase. So Ecommerce mobile apps make sense only for repetitive purchases. Mixpanel reports that the average web retention rate is 10.3%. It means that you are going to develop a mobile app for 1 of 10 website visitors. For all the rest, your solution will be useless.

High cost

Your mobile app should have at least standard features that enable visitors to make purchases. These features include:

  • Full product catalog
  • Branded design
  • Order placing
  • Online payments;
  • Push notifications.

The Ecommerce app development cost can reach $3,000-5,000 for a solution with this minimal set of features. Any advanced additions like unique design can increase the overall price by several times. So when considering building a mobile app for your online store, take in mind that will cost you a lot.

You need to develop two different apps

When considering creating a mobile app for your online store, you should remember that, in fact, you will need two separate apps for iOS- and Android-based devices. Therefore, you can double your estimated overall app development cost. You can’t just ignore the interests of the large audience part since it can affect your company’s image. However, you can build an Ecommerce app for one specific operating system to test the idea or build a simple cross-platform solution for both iOS and Android.

Continuous testing

Unfortunately, you can’t just invest once and forget about your app. In fact, you should continuously test it to make sure it works perfectly. With new iOS and Android versions arising, you have to adjust your existing Ecommerce mobile app to them in order to ensure its compatibility. Otherwise, you put your investments at a risk of becoming worthless if your customers can no longer use it once they get the last system updates.

App promotion

Even if your online store is successful, users won’t form a queue to download and install your app. One way or another, you should create another marketing campaign to promote your app. Placing App Store and Google Play logos with corresponding links on your website isn’t enough for your mobile solution to become popular. In addition, you will need to hire an app store optimization (ASO) specialist who will have to increase the visibility of your Ecommerce mobile app in Apple’s App Store and Google Play.

Any additional improvements will cost you money

With the rising of new mobile app development trends, you won’t be able to ignore them. At least, you shouldn’t. Over time, you will need to change your app design or add new features. All these improvements will significantly reduce your overall budget. Furthermore, such additional expenses can exceed the initial Ecommerce app development cost.

Limited analytics

Google Analytics provides a wide range of tools that can help you track your app success. With Google’s service, you can monitor how users explore your solutions: which screens they prefer, how long they’ve been using your app until delete it, how many customers have downloaded it. However, web analytics tools provide much more advanced capabilities and provide you with a better control over marketing channels. For example, with web analytics, you can promote particular products or categories on the internet by referring to specific web pages rather than promoting the whole app.

Putting your eggs in different baskets

With an Ecommerce mobile app, you will need to monitor your traffic on one resource more. This will create an additional workload on your marketing departments thus increasing your expenses. This is the case where “don’t put all your eggs in one basket” is not applicable.

When you should create an Ecommerce mobile app

eBay Ecommerce mobile app

Taking into account the above-mentioned benefits and drawbacks of Ecommerce mobile apps, it can seem that this idea is worthless and you shouldn’t create one for your online store. Well, it’s not actually true. While most Ecommerce businesses really don’t need it, for a narrow range of online stores a mobile app can be a profitable investment. Here’s when you should start building an app for your company.

High retention rate

As mentioned above, a mobile app makes sense only for repetitive purchases. A high retention rate is a characteristic that may encourage you to invest in the Ecommerce app development. For those customers who are planning to buy more in your online store in the future will appreciate the simplified checkout process in your mobile app. As soon as your retention reaches the value of at least 15%, you can start building your app.

Loyal audience

The loyal audience generates repetitive purchases but it can include those customers who will rarely buy something in your store. Instead, they appreciate your service and can monitor prices or check characteristics of new products in your online store. Such customers are influencers who can encourage other people to become your clients by talking about their positive experience of the cooperation with you. The whole loyal audience deserves your app. If your calculations show that your Ecommerce app for this audience will pay off, then you should develop it.

Your website generates over 10,000 visits per day

it makes no sense to invest thousands or even tens of thousand dollars in the Ecommerce app development if only a couple of hundred people visits your online store every day. In this case, you will create an app for less than a hundred users. Does it worth it? Furthermore, most of them will remove your app after one week according to Mixpanel. However, if you have a monthly traffic of over 300,000 visitors, you can hire a dedicated team to develop a high-end mobile app for your online store.

Tools to develop an Ecommerce mobile app without coding

In the case where your budget is extremely limited, but you still need a typical mobile app with a basic set of features for your online store, you can turn towards Ecommerce app builders that will enable you to create a mobile solution in a drag-and-drop manner.


AppyPie is an Ecommerce app builder that offers 15 simple layouts that allow you to create a mobile solution with a decent design. However, they are easy to edit. You can add your own background pictures and change default colors. One of the best features of AppyPie is that it supports the integration with such content management systems (CMS) as:

  • Shopify
  • Magento
  • WordPress along with the WooCommerce plugin
  • Etsy
  • Groupon
  • Amazon
  • Ebay, etc.


The tool also enables you to receive payments from your customers via Paypal or credit/debit cards via the PayPal gateway. In addition, you can add the cash on delivery payment method for those who need to be sure they will get what they’ve paid for. Furthermore, AppyPie has the Mailchimp integration feature as well as Analytics tools that offer 100 free emails for your customers.


  • $15/month: an Android-based app with AppyPie branding; push notifications – 5,000, disk space – 200MB; monthly bandwidth – 4GB.
  • $30/month: an Android-based app and progressive web app (PWA). Push notifications 0 10,000; disk space – 400MB; monthly bandwidth – 8GB.
  • $50/month. An app based on Android, iOS, Blackberry, Windows, Fire OS, and HTML5; push notifications – 25000 , disk space – 600MB; monthly bandwidth – 12GB.

AppyPie charges yearly. You also can try a free package with ads in your app.


Mobimatic is another Ecommerce mobile app builder that allows you to create a highly optimized solution with a modern design by dragging and dropping blocks on your display. This cloud-based software offers users to develop mobile apps for both iOS and Android operating systems.


With Mobimatic, you can offer discounts to your customers and get collect their data when they register a coupon. Furthermore, you can configure coupon expiry dates or set the number of times customers can use them. The tool offers more than 80 different layouts that allow you to configure your app design according to your preferences. You can choose any Ecommerce app template, add your text as well as change colors, styles and background images.


The web application enables users to create full-fledged product catalogs with a card, image galleries, filters, notes, and options. With Mobimatic, you also can add different payment options like credit or debit card, cash on delivery, and PayPal. In addition, the tool can synchronize your products and categories from any CMS from the following list:

  • Shopify
  • WordPress (the Woocommerce plugin)
  • Magento
  • Prestashop
  • Opencart, etc.


  • $ 67 Per Month
  • $ 647 Per year (about $54 per month)
  • $ 1697 lifetime

All the above-mentioned packages offer the same capabilities. You can choose one of them according to your payment preferences.

Final thoughts

An Ecommerce mobile app in addition to your responsive website is a huge hole in your budget. Customers won’t download and install your app to make purchases once a year or even every six months. In most cases where you think whether or not you need to create a mobile app for your store, the answer is no because, for those companies that really can benefit from it, the question is out of their agenda.


With their huge loyal audience and lots of repetitive purchases, such Ecommerce businesses as Amazon or Ebay understand that a mobile app is what their customers need rather than what these companies want to offer them. Otherwise, you will just develop an app as a means of the image element instead of another income generating channel. So build an Ecommerce app only when you’re sure this idea will definitely pay off.